Joe McCray is a basketball player born on September 27, 1984 in Ft. lauderdale, fl. His height is six foot five (1m95 / 6-5). He is a point guard / shooting guard who most recently played for Nebraska Cornhuskers in NCAA.

Joe McCray - Points
Joe McCray scores a career high 26 points (2005)
On February 08, 2005, Joe McCray set his career high in points in a NCAA game. That day he scored 26 points in Nebraska Cornhuskers's home loss against Iowa State Cyclones, 60-65. He also had 5 rebounds, 3 assists, 3 steals. He shot 3/4 from two, 4/11 from three, shooting at 46.7% from the field. He also shot 8/9 from the free-throw line.
